Analysis

In 2024, share of one-year-olds vaccinated against diphtheria, tetanus and pertussis in Greece stood at 95.0%.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 4.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, share of one-year-olds vaccinated against diphtheria, tetanus and pertussis in Greece peaked at 99.0% in 2007 and was at its lowest, 54.0%, in 1985.

That places Greece 60th out of 194 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 45 years of available data.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1980s 73.5% 54.0% 95.0% 10
1990s 85.4% 54.0% 90.0% 10
2000s 95.2% 89.0% 99.0% 10
2010s 99.0% 99.0% 99.0% 10
2020s 97.2% 95.0% 99.0% 5
